School of Legal Studies, CMR University offers the flagship BALLB Hons programme in a variety of specializations. The course is a popular programme for students seeking to build a career in Law. The total tuition fees for CMR Law College BALLB Hons is INR 7.5 L. CMR Law College BALLB Hons admissions are conducted on the basis of entrance tests. Accepted examinations include CLAT, LSAT India, and CMRUAT.

The basic eligibility requirement to get admission into the BTech course at UAS Dharwad and CCS HAU is almost similar, in which candidates must complete their Class 12 from the Science stream with an aggregate of 50%. Further, for the selection process, CAU accepts relevant ICAR CUET/ CCS HAU entrance scores. On the other hand, UAS Dharwad accepts relevant scores of ICAR CUET/ KCET. Hence, the only difference is the type of entrance exam accepted for the BTech course. Candidates can choose any of them that align with their career choices, location preferences, and affordability.

No, students cannot take admission to UVCE Bangalore BTech courses without appearing for Karnataka CET. Having a valid KCET score is part of the minimum eligibility criteria. Moreover, the allocation of seats is done via KCET counselling. Interested students can apply for the counselling process by visiting the official website of the institute.

Students who get a BTech seat at UVCE Bangalore via KCET counselling must complete the document verification process. Check out the below list to know all the documents required to complete the process:
- Class 10 and 12 marksheets
- Recent passport-size photograph (colour)
- Copy of Aadhar Card (Indian Citizens)
- Copy of Valid Passport (International Citizens)
- Digital Signatures
- Category certificate
- Income certificate

For admission to UVCE Bangalore BTech courses, students can take the KCET exam. The application fees for KCET 2025 is as follows:
- Karnataka (GM, 2A, 2B, 3A, 3B): INR 500
- Karnataka (SC, ST, CAT-1): INR 250
- Karnataka (All Female Candidates of Karnataka): INR 250
- Outside Karnataka (GM): INR 750
- Outside India (GM): INR 5,000
